Congratulations! Mrs. de Silva, our BRCVPA General Music teacher, was invited to present at the American Orff-Schulwerk Association Conference in November. We are delighted to have a leader in the music community representing BRCVPA!
Mrs. de Silva also earned her Level 2 Orff Certification this summer by attending a two week course at Texas A&M Kingsville. Well done, Mrs. de Silva! We are all extremely proud of you!

BRCVPA teachers (Mrs. Stacey Elston, Mrs. Karen Dafoe, and Ms. Janai James) spent the past week playing with legos, learning the fundamentals of coding, exploring robotics, and learning how to teach students to play chess. The summer workshop was sponsored by the Foundation for the East Baton Rouge Parish School System. The Baton Rouge Mounted Patrol Unit from the Baton Rouge Police Force came out to provide our campers with a demonstration of their day to day activities. Students were excited to meet the officers and their equestrian partners as they learned how the officers help keep our community safe.
